Cast me age 42 (the planner), DH 42 (his job was to drive and pay! hehe), DS age 9, DM age 73, sis age 35, my two nieces ages 5 and 8!

We had a great time--went to Disney Studios on Monday, Epcot on Tuesday, BB Wednesday morning, then to MK around 5:30 and stayed for EMH evening. Thursday back to MK, Friday was animal kingdom.

Disney studios----DH, sis, DS and oldest niece did TOT--I don't like drops so I sat this one out. Then onto to Rock "N roller coaster--we all LOVED it! Later I decided to try TOT and I liked it better than I thought I would. The back lot tour was such a HUGE waste of time!!!! Unless you are really, really, really, (and I mean REALLY) into movies skip this ride, it takes too long and I thought it was boring. We stayed and watched Fantasmic and we all were amazed by this show! Do NOT miss this show. We got in line at 7:50 and got great seats--about seven rows up right smack in the middle isle! :Pinkbounc

Epcot---Rode TT first, we all loved it even my Mom! After reading about some reviews about Mission space I decided to skip this one too, but after my DH, Sis, DS and DN came back and loved it and no one felt quesey or dizzy I decided to try it and OMG, I LOVED it and I didn't feel bad at all! I wanted to do it again but we didn't have time. :( I really encourage you to ride this, it was amazing. The kids really loved the viking boat ride at Norway, they had to do this twice! Also loved Journey into your Imagination, and The energy ride with Ellen (can't remember the name of it now :crazy: ), although we are Christians and don't believe in the big bang theory--other than that we really enjoyed the ride.

BB---it was okay, although I'll admit I'm not much of a water person. We rode the family raft ride which was a blast! A couple of other raft rides which were fun, played in the wave pool which was fun especially for the kids, also did the lazy river which was nice but it was very crowded. I wouldn't do BB again, I wished we had just stayed at the pool at our resort (PC) and relaxed that morning.

MK---got there around 5:00 for our PS at CP ate dinner then went to POC--walked right on, my five year old niece did not like it at all she was scared, same thing with HM. We then did Swiss family tree house which the kids and my mom enjoyed---saw a woman standing there giving out the wrist bands for EMH that night so we got ours. The first hour of EMH was a zoo!!! Right after the fireworks we headed to Peter Pan and had to wait for 30 minutes to ride it!!! What I couldn't understand was the amount of parents carrying sleeping toddlers and then waking them up when they got on the ride. Poor kids! They were exhausted! I don't understand that at all. The longer the night went the less crowds there were though. We left at 11:15. Oh yes, one more thing we did the Jungle cruise that night and I'm sorry but this is getting old, I think they need to do something about it, after waiting for almost 15 minutes and then the ride is several minutes as well I really felt I wasted my time.

MK again on Thursday, we got there early and did most of the rides without much of a wait, we did use a couple of fast passes though. We left around 6:00 that evening we were SO tired.

Friday ---AK, well we weren't impressed at all and we are all animal lovers, the safari was nice and we saw several animals, but we've been to some great zoos in our life, so although I loved the theming it still seemed just like an elebrate zoo to me. I wish Dinosaur wasn't down, because I'm sure we would have loved that ride. We rode PW, it was just okay---15 minute wait for a very short ride. Kali river rapids was fun but WAY too short. In short I'm not sorry I went to AK, but I doubt that we'd ever go back. I'd skip AK for Universal Studios anyday.

Highlights of our trip was first and foremost Fantasmic wonderful and unbelieveable---after seeing it we were 'almost' disappointed in Wishes and Illuminations, they were good, but can't compare to Fantasmic.

The other highlights were Mission Space, Rock 'N Roller coast and our old favorites space moutain and splash mountain.

All in all a great trip, with moderate crowds (Epcot seemed to be the less crowded of them all).
